279-282: Consider using more robust JSON parsingThe current implementation uses simple byte matching to detect the error code, which could potentially match unrelated content containing the same string pattern.
-func isUnknownWebhook(_body io.ReadCloser) bool { - body, _ := ioutil.ReadAll(_body) - _body.Close() - return bytes.Contains(body, []byte("\"code\": 10015")) -} +func isUnknownWebhook(_body io.ReadCloser) bool { + body, _ := ioutil.ReadAll(_body) + _body.Close() + + var errorResponse struct { + Code int `json:"code"` + } + + if err := json.Unmarshal(body, &errorResponse); err != nil { + return false + } + + return errorResponse.Code == 10015 +}

10-20: Preserve multi-value headers and skip hop-by-hop fieldscopyHeader lower-cases keys and collapses multi-value headers to the last value. Prefer preserving all values and excluding hop-by-hop headers (Connection, TE, Trailer). Also, if you intend to drop Date from upstream, don’t re-add it.
func copyHeader(dst, src http.Header) { - dst["Date"] = nil - dst["Content-Type"] = nil - for k, vv := range src { - for _, v := range vv { - if k != "Content-Length" { - dst[strings.ToLower(k)] = []string{v} - } - } - } + dst.Del("Date") + dst.Del("Content-Type") + dst.Del("Content-Length") + for k, vv := range src { + if strings.EqualFold(k, "Content-Length") || + strings.EqualFold(k, "Connection") || + strings.EqualFold(k, "Transfer-Encoding") || + strings.EqualFold(k, "Trailer") { + continue + } + // Preserve all values; let net/http canonicalize on write. + dst[k] = append([]string(nil), vv...) + } }lib/process_request_test.go (2)
